Uruguay: Mujeres y género están ausentes en medios latinoamericanos, según informe

Submitted by iKNOW Politics on
Back

Uruguay: Mujeres y género están ausentes en medios latinoamericanos, según informe

Source:

Las mujeres en su papel como políticas y los temas de igualdad de género están "preocupantemente ausentes" en la cobertura mediática que se realiza en las campañas electorales de América Latina, según apunta un informe presentado hoy en Uruguay por ONU Mujeres y la organización Idea Internacional.

UN Trust Fund to End Violence against Women announces over US$8 million in grants

Submitted by Anónimo (no verificado) on
Back

UN Trust Fund to End Violence against Women announces over US$8 million in grants

Source:

The United Nations Trust Fund to End Violence against Women (UN Trust Fund) today kicked off its 16th year announcing more than US$8 million in grants to 12 local initiatives in 18 countries.

UN Security Council calls on the international community to support the role of women’s civil society organizations in peacebuilding

Submitted by Anónimo (no verificado) on
Back

UN Security Council calls on the international community to support the role of women’s civil society organizations in peacebuilding

Source:

On 31 October, UN Women Executive Director Michelle Bachelet took part in a special meeting of the UN Security Council in which the Guatemalan Presidency presented its statement for the annual review of progress in implementing resolution 1325 (2000) on women and peace and security.

Women of Mali call for increased protection and involvement in resolving the conflict

Submitted by Anónimo (no verificado) on
Back

Women of Mali call for increased protection and involvement in resolving the conflict

Source:

“This occupation is the cruelest one that the Malian people have had to undergo, nowadays women are deprived of all liberties and even the choice of a husband is dictated to them by the occupying forces, “says a displaced woman* living in Bamako and originally from Timbuktu - a city occupied by armed groups today.
